DISCOVERING PARAVOLLEY

There are two main disciplines of ParaVolley – click on the images below to find out more:

Beach ParaVolley (Standing)                                   Sitting Volleyball

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Whilst the beach side is still emerging and growing into the force we know it can be, the sitting game has become on of the highlights of the Paralympic Games AND also a truly inclusive sport played by anyone and everyone around the world at club level.

People get involved in ParaVolley for a wide range of different reasons, including; social/community, health and fitness, competition opportunities, but mainly because it is a fun thing to be a part of…

BECOMING A CLASSIFIER

Classifiers are those who assess physical impairment in athletes prior to international competition.  More information about becoming one can be found here.
